Pakistani Government Allocates 2,000MW for Bitcoin Mining and AI Data Centers: Major Boost for Crypto Market

According to Charles | dYdX on Twitter, the Pakistani government has officially allocated 2,000 megawatts of electricity for the development of Bitcoin mining operations and AI data centers, as reported by Dawn.com. This large-scale energy allocation signals a significant move towards institutional crypto mining in South Asia, offering a strong foundation for mining infrastructure and attracting potential foreign investment. The decision is expected to enhance Bitcoin network security, increase hash rate, and potentially lower mining costs due to cheaper local power. Crypto traders should monitor Pakistani regulatory updates and global hash rate distribution trends, as this development could influence Bitcoin's price stability and bring new liquidity into the market (source: dawn.com/news/1913238; @charlesdhaussy).
